    Wallpaper paste gel stronger and cheaper, gives zero wrinkles in paper. I use it by the big tub to avoid all the plastic of glue stick tubes going to the landfill. Perfect for collage and visual journalling including these larger pieces.

    @ogposhgeek1735 Рік тому +2

    Your process is so interesting and such a clever way to add layers of interest and texture to your work. You may want to exercise caution when it comes to putting water-based mediums (which is the function the Mod Podge is fulfilling) over oil. The water-based paints or varnishes can lose their ability to stick to oil over time. If you’re painting on top of acrylic you should be fine. A quick Google will tell you more. Good luck and happy thrifting!

    • @REISSUED
      @REISSUED  Рік тому +2

      Hey there! Yes, both thrifted painting were done in acrylics this time. But I have one beautiful thrifted piece in my home that I tried to varnish… and it was oil based… for the varnish beaded up right away. I quickly removed that and since purchased an oil based varnish to seal it with. Great reminder! Thanks!
